🚀PROMO #PLANCARRERA2024 - 🔥Bonificaciones, Precios Congelados y Cuotas

 X 

✒️ABAP Las Estructuras Append

ABAP Las Estructuras Append

ABAP Las Estructuras Append1 | ¿Qué es una Estructura Append?

Estructura Append: Es un objeto de ABAP que se crea para agregar datos y configuraciones adicionales a las tablas y estructuras estándar de SAP.

También son conocidas como Ampliaciones de tablas de base de datos. Con una Estructura Append se podrán realizar las siguientes modificaciones a una tabla base de datos o estructura:

  • Insertar nuevos campos a una tabla o estructura.
  • Definir claves foráneas para campos de la tabla.
  • Agregar Ayudas de búsqueda para campos de la tabla.

Los campos que agreguemos en una Estructura Append deben tener la nomenclatura propia del usuario, es decir deben comenzar con ZZ o con YY, ya que de esta forma se previene que existan conflictos con los nombres de los campos estándar de SAP.

Al momento de crear una Estructura Append es importante tener en cuenta las siguientes características:

Una Estructura Append puede ser asignada a más de una tabla o estructura.

Si se quiere insertar un campo a una tabla o estructura que se sabe que será agregado por SAP en la próxima versión estándar del sistema, se deberá incluir el mismo en la tabla o estructura como una reparación. De otra forma, al momento de actualizarse el sistema, existirán dos campos iguales lo que producirá un error. Cuando hablamos de reparación nos referimos al tipo de la orden de transporte.

Si se copia una tabla o estructura que contiene una Estructura Append a otra Tabla o estructura, los campos de la Estructura Append se convertirán en parte de los campos de la tabla o estructura destino. Lo mismo sucederá con las claves foráneas y las ayudas de búsqueda.

Se podrán crear nuevas claves foráneas o ayudas de búsqueda mediante una Estructura Append en una tabla o estructura, pero no se podrá modificar las claves foráneas o ayudas de búsqueda existentes mediante una Estructura Append.

No se podrá agregar una Estructura Append a una tabla base de datos si la Estructura Append contiene alguno de los siguientes tipos de datos: VARC, LCHR o LRAW. Esto se debe a que son campos largos y deben ser los últimos campos de la tabla base de datos. Sin embargo, esta excepción no existe para la estructuras.

2 | ¿Cómo crear una Estructura Append?

Las Estructuras Append se crean a través de la transacción SE11. Vamos a crear una Estructura Append para la tabla de vuelos SFLIGHT. Para ello, presionamos el botón Estructura Append.

Tabla SFLIGHT

La tabla base de datos SFLIGHT es una tabla estándar del sistema SAP que contiene información sobre Vuelos y que generalmente es utilizada para realizar programas de prueba o demo en el sistema.

Otra tabla base de datos similar y muy comúnmente utilizada con el mismo propósito es la tabla SPFLI.

En la ventana de diálogo que vemos a continuación introducimos el nombre de la Estructura Append.

Ahora indicaremos los campos que queremos incorporar en la estructura, de la misma forma que se realiza en el diccionario de datos, luego grabamos y activamos la estructura.

Finalmente podremos observar que la tabla SFLIGHT posee una Estructura Append, que contiene los campos adicionales que incorporamos, como anexo a la estructura original de la tabla.

AUDIO ACLARATIVO: Cuando creamos o modificamos una tabla base de datos o una estructura del diccionario de datos ABAP, podemos clasificarla en relación a si será actualizada o ampliada mediante una estructura APPEND. Las ampliaciones no se refieren solo a las propias estructuras o tablas, sino también a estructuras dependientes que copian la ampliación como estructura referenciada. Esta clasificación se realiza desde la transacción SE11 accediendo al menú detalles, categoría de ampliación. Las opciones que disponemos para la clasificación de la categoría de ampliación son las siguientes: Seleccionar la opción no clasificado, que significa que la tabla base de datos o estructura no tiene categoría de ampliación; Seleccionar la opción no ampliable, la cual significa que la tabla base de datos, su estructura no podrá ser ampliada mediante una estructura APPEND; Seleccionar la opción ampliable y de caracteres que significa que todos los componentes de la tabla o estructura y sus ampliaciones deben estar formados por caracteres, es decir, campos de tipo CNDOT; Seleccionar la opción ampliable y de caracteres o numérica en donde la tabla base de datos, su estructura y su ampliación no puede contener tipos de datos como tablas, referencias o strings; También podemos seleccionar la opción ampliable de cualquier forma, si la tabla base de datos, su estructura y su ampliación puede tener componentes con un tipo de datos cualquiera; por último, seleccionar la opción no Clasificada para un estado transitorio mientras se decide la categoría correspondiente.


 

 

 


Sobre el autor

Publicación académica de Pedro Antonio Duarte, en su ámbito de estudios para la Carrera Consultor ABAP.

SAP Master


Pedro Antonio Duarte

Profesión: Consultor de Sap Abap - Argentina - Legajo: JP24O

✒️Autor de: 128 Publicaciones Académicas

🎓Egresado de los módulos:

Disponibilidad Laboral: FullTime

Certificación Académica de Pedro Duarte

✒️+Comunidad Académica CVOSOFT

Continúe aprendiendo sobre el tema "Las Estructuras Append" de la mano de nuestros alumnos.

SAP Master

Estructuras Append Las estructuras APPEND permiten ampliar tablas o estructuras agregando campos que no son parte del estándard , sin tener que modificar la tabla o estructura de la misma.Se crean para ser utilizadas sólo en una tabla o estructura específica. Cuando se activa una tabla o estructura, el sistema activa todas las estructuras append asociadas. Si una estructura append es creada o modificada y luego activada, la tabla o estructura correspondiente también se activa y todas las modificaciones realizadas a las estructuras append toman efecto en el objeto al que pertenecen . Los campos de las estructuras append se utilizan en los programas ABAP como cualquier otro campo de la tabla o estructura original ....

Acceder a esta publicación

Creado y Compartido por: Juan Carlos Ayala Chira

*** CVOSOFT - Nuestros Alumnos - Nuestro Mayor Orgullo como Academia ***

SAP Master

ESTRUCTURAS APPEND: Es un objeto de ABAP que se crea para agregar datos y configuraciones adicionales a las tablas y estructuras de datos de SAP. COMO CREAR UNA ESTRUCTURA APPEND. Se crean a través de la transacción SE11. 1.- Visualizamos la tabla o la estructura que se le va a agregar la ampliación. 2.- Presionamos el botón "Estructura Append". 3.- En la ventana de diálogo introducimos el nombre de la estructura. 4.- En la proxima ventana, indicaremos los campos que queremos incorporar a la estructura. 5.- Grabamos y Activamos la estructura. 6.- Finalmente vemos que la tabla o estructura, posee una estructura append que contiene los campos adicionales que incorporamos.

Acceder a esta publicación

Creado y Compartido por: Maria Ysabel Colina De Magdaleno

*** CVOSOFT - Nuestros Alumnos - Nuestro Mayor Orgullo como Academia ***

SAP Master

Estructuras Append Es un objeto ABAP que se crea para agregar datos y configuraciones adicionales a tablas y estructuras estándar Se puede hacer: Insertar campos en tablas y estructuras Definir claves foráneas Agregar ayudas de búsqueda Creación: Tx SE11 -> estructura/tabla -> botón "Estructura Append"

Acceder a esta publicación

Creado y Compartido por: Xavier Martinez Garsaball

*** CVOSOFT - Nuestros Alumnos - Nuestro Mayor Orgullo como Academia ***

SAP Master

las estructuras append son objetos que se emplean para agregar datos y configuraciones adicionales a las tablas y estructuras estandar de SAP. (ampliaciones de tablas de la base de datos) las estructuras pueden ser asignadas a mas de una tabla, sin embargo no se podra agregar la estructura si contiene datos del tipo VARC, LCHR, LRAW las estructuras se crean con la tx SE11

Acceder a esta publicación

Creado y Compartido por: Eduardo Vargas

*** CVOSOFT - Nuestros Alumnos - Nuestro Mayor Orgullo como Academia ***

SAP Senior

Los APPEND son ampliaciones de SAP que permiten añadir campos a las tablas y estructuras, así como agregar datos. También se podrán definir claves ajenas y ayudas de búsqueda. Los campos de un APPEND deberán comenzar por ZZ o YY. Estas ampliaciones se pueden asignar a más de una tabla. Las APPEND que contengan los tipos de datos VARC, LCHR o LRAW no se podrán agregar a una tabla de base de datos. * TRANSACCIONES SE11 --> Actualización del diccionario de datos. También se emplea para crear ampliaciones APPEND.

Acceder a esta publicación

Creado y Compartido por: Francisco Javier López Andreu

*** CVOSOFT - Nuestros Alumnos - Nuestro Mayor Orgullo como Academia ***

SAP Master

Estructura Append Es un objeto de ABAP para agregar datosy configuraciones adicionales a las tablas y estructuras estandar de SAP Tambien son conocidas como ampliaciones de tablas de base de datos . Insertar nuevos campos a una tabla o estructura. Definir claves foraneas para campos de la tabla agregar ayudas de busqueda para los campos de la tabla. Mediante la transaccion SE11. se crean las estructuras append

Acceder a esta publicación

Creado y Compartido por: Andres Felipe Escobar Lopez

*** CVOSOFT - Nuestros Alumnos - Nuestro Mayor Orgullo como Academia ***

SAP Master

Estructura append: Objetos de ABAP que se crea para agregar datos adicionales a tablas y estructuras estándar de SAP. Como crear una estructura append: Transacción SE11. Ver la estructura que se quiera ampliar. Presionar botón 'Estr.append...'. Introducir nombre de la estructura de ampliación. Empieza por ZZ*. Pestaña componentes. Añadir cada uno de los campos de la estructura de ampliación (los campos de tipo moneda especificar en la pestaña''Campos de moneda/cantidad). Grabar y activar.

Acceder a esta publicación

Creado y Compartido por: Javier Exposito Diaz

*** CVOSOFT - Nuestros Alumnos - Nuestro Mayor Orgullo como Academia ***

SAP Master

Lección 5: Estructuras Append. [ 5º de 9 ] 1.- Estructura Append. Es un objeto de ABAP que se crea para agregar datos y configuraciones adicionales a las tablas y estructuras estándar de SAP. También se les conoce como Ampliaciones de tablas de base de datos se podrán realizar las siguientes modificaciones: Insertar nuevos campos a una tabla o estructura. Definir claves foráneas para campos de la tabla. Agregar Ayudas de búsqueda para campos de la tabla. Los campos que agreguemos deben tener la nomenclatura propia del usuario, es decir comenzar con ZZ con YY, ya que de esta manera se previene que existan conflictos con los nombres de los campos estándar. 2.- Como crear una Estructua...

Acceder a esta publicación

Creado y Compartido por: Jose Angel Valles Bustos

*** CVOSOFT - Nuestros Alumnos - Nuestro Mayor Orgullo como Academia ***

SAP Senior

ESTRUCTURA APPEND. Conocidas como ampliaciones de tablas, son objetos para agregar datos y configuraciones adicionales a las tablas y estructuras estándar de SAP. * Insertar campos (deben iniciar con ZZ). * Definir claves foráneas. * Agregar Ayuda de Búsqueda. No se pueden agregar estructuras Append a una Tabla de Datos, si la estructura contiene tipo de dato VARC, LCHR, LRAW ya que son campos largos. Para crear una ampliacion es SE 11 >Tabla > Estructura Append Al crear una tabla / estructura se clasifica si sera ampliada o no. SE 11 >Tabla > Detalles(Extras) > Categoráa de Ampliación(Enhancement Category) * No Clasificada - no tiene categoráa de ampliación....

Acceder a esta publicación

Creado y Compartido por: Hazel Maribel Flores Martin

*** CVOSOFT - Nuestros Alumnos - Nuestro Mayor Orgullo como Academia ***

SAP Master

Lección 5: Estructuras Append. 1.- Estructura Append. Es un objeto de ABAP que se crea para agregar datos y configuraciones adicionales a las tablas y estructuras estándar de SAP. También se les conoce como Ampliaciones de tablas de base de datos se podrán realizar las siguientes modificaciones: Insertar nuevos campos a una tabla o estructura. Definir claves foráneas para campos de la tabla. Agregar Ayudas de búsqueda para campos de la tabla. Los campos que agreguemos deben tener la nomenclatura propia del usuario, es decir comenzar con ZZ con YY, ya que de esta manera se previene que existan conflictos con los nombres de los campos estándar. 2.- Como crear una Estructua Append....

Acceder a esta publicación

Creado y Compartido por: Calixto Gutiérrez

 


 

👌Genial!, estos fueron los últimos artículos sobre más de 79.000 publicaciones académicas abiertas, libres y gratuitas compartidas con la comunidad, para acceder a ellas le dejamos el enlace a CVOPEN ACADEMY.

Buscador de Publicaciones:

 


 

No sea Juan... Solo podrá llegar alto si realiza su formación con los mejores!